If you are struggling with ROM sets, consider the core. This plays the CD releases of Neo Geo games. They have slower load times (even emulated) and rearranged music (Redbook audio), but they require no BIOS fiddling and use simple .cue/bin files. neo geo roms for retroarch

Unlike console emulation where a single file contains the entire game, arcade emulation relies on specific ROM sets. To prevent errors, you must understand how these files interact. MAME vs. FB Neo Sets
